Abstract: | The National Creative Placemaking Fund is looking for projects that use arts and culture to effect change in a geographic community. A project should include the following: Focus on a neighborhood, town, village, or other geographic community Looks to work on a community challenge or opportunity related to agriculture/food; economic development; education’/youth; environment/energy; health; housing; immigration; public safety; transportation; or workforce development. Has a way that artists, arts organizations, and/or arts and culture activities can help address that challenge or opportunity Will have a way of knowing whether the project has made progress on the challenge.
